新聞中心
py解析用法?
在Python中,解析是指將一個(gè)數(shù)據(jù)結(jié)構(gòu)轉(zhuǎn)換為另一種形式的過程。常見的用法包括將字符串解析為其他數(shù)據(jù)類型,如將字符串解析為整數(shù)或浮點(diǎn)數(shù);將文本文件解析為數(shù)據(jù)結(jié)構(gòu),如將CSV文件解析為字典或列表;還有將復(fù)雜的數(shù)據(jù)結(jié)構(gòu)解析為簡(jiǎn)單的數(shù)據(jù)類型,如將JSON數(shù)據(jù)解析為Python數(shù)據(jù)類型。

解析的過程可以通過內(nèi)置的函數(shù)或第三方庫實(shí)現(xiàn),如使用內(nèi)置的int()函數(shù)將字符串解析為整數(shù),使用Pandas庫將CSV文件解析為數(shù)據(jù)框。解析在數(shù)據(jù)處理和數(shù)據(jù)交互中起著重要的作用,能夠方便地將不同形式的數(shù)據(jù)轉(zhuǎn)換為可處理的格式。
Py解析通常指使用Python解析特定類型的數(shù)據(jù),比如XML、JSON、CSV等。解析通常涉及將數(shù)據(jù)轉(zhuǎn)換成Python對(duì)象或使用Python的庫來訪問和操作數(shù)據(jù)。使用Py解析可以使數(shù)據(jù)在Python環(huán)境中可讀性更好,并且可以方便地對(duì)數(shù)據(jù)進(jìn)行處理和分析。對(duì)于處理大量數(shù)據(jù)或需要與外部系統(tǒng)交互的應(yīng)用程序,Py的解析功能是至關(guān)重要的。
py解析是 Python 編程語言中的一個(gè)重要概念,在數(shù)據(jù)處理和解析方面起著關(guān)鍵作用。它可以用于提取、分析和處理各種數(shù)據(jù)類型,包括文本、JSON、XML 等。通過使用相應(yīng)的庫或模塊,可以實(shí)現(xiàn)對(duì)數(shù)據(jù)的解析和處理。例如,使用 BeautifulSoup 庫對(duì) HTML 標(biāo)簽進(jìn)行解析,或使用 json 模塊對(duì) JSON 數(shù)據(jù)進(jìn)行解析。
在實(shí)際應(yīng)用中,py解析通常用于數(shù)據(jù)采集、網(wǎng)頁解析、數(shù)據(jù)清洗等領(lǐng)域,為數(shù)據(jù)分析和處理提供了重要的支持。因此,掌握 py解析的用法對(duì)于 Python 開發(fā)者來說是至關(guān)重要的。
pattern = re.compile('
+'.*?>(.*?)
.*?star">(.*?).*?releasetime">(.*?)'+'.*?integer">(.*?).*?fraction">(.*?).*?
items = re.findall(pattern, html
csv導(dǎo)出來的身份證如何變成數(shù)字?
回答如下:可以使用Python編程語言中的pandas庫將CSV文件讀取為數(shù)據(jù)框,然后使用正則表達(dá)式提取出身份證號(hào)碼中的數(shù)字部分,并將其轉(zhuǎn)換為整數(shù)類型。以下是示例代碼:
```python
import pandas as pd
import re
# 讀取CSV文件為數(shù)據(jù)框
df = pd.read_csv('data.csv')
# 定義正則表達(dá)式模式匹配身份證號(hào)碼中的數(shù)字部分
pattern = re.compile(r'\d+')
# 將身份證號(hào)碼中的數(shù)字部分提取出來,并轉(zhuǎn)換為整數(shù)類型
df['身份證號(hào)碼'] = df['身份證號(hào)碼'].apply(lambda x: int(''.join(pattern.findall(x))))
到此,以上就是小編對(duì)于pandas find函數(shù)的問題就介紹到這了,希望這2點(diǎn)解答對(duì)大家有用。
新聞標(biāo)題:py解析用法?(Pandas中findall()方法如何使用)
本文路徑:http://fisionsoft.com.cn/article/dpdieoe.html


咨詢
建站咨詢
